Peggy is our hostess this week and she has chosen: Perfect Plum, Smoky Slate, Pink Pirouette and for dessert: use, or make your own dsp. For this card I passed on dessert.
On separate cs, I splattered some masking fluid and let dry. Then I embossed some of the floral stamps so they would stay white, and sponged around the card with all 3 colors. I stamped some of the flowers randomly around the card and then cleaned up the embossed images and rubbed off the masking fluid. I love the added look this created. Stamped the sentiment, die cut the butterfly and matted with a border of white and then attached to the plum card front. Added 1 gem to the butterfly. This also works for our CAS challenge: wings.
